Before you start disassembling, you need to make sure that the problem lies precisely in the electronics or mechanics sensor, and not a freon leak or a compressor malfunction. Thermostat responsible for opening and closing the compressor power circuit depending on the temperature inside the chamber. If this mechanism “sticks” or gives incorrect readings, the cooling cycle is disrupted, which leads to the consequences described above.

Diagnostics of thermostat malfunction

The first sign that thermostat requires attention is incorrect compressor operation. It can work non-stop, ignoring the set settings, or turn on extremely rarely, not having time to cool the chamber volume to the required values. In models Minsk refrigeratorsequipped with a compressor operation indicator lamp, it can be constantly on, even when the motor is silent, which indicates “sticking” of the contacts in the closed position.

For an initial check, you can conduct a simple experiment: defrost the unit completely, then turn it on and set the regulator to the minimum value (usually the number 1 or "Min"). If after 15-20 minutes of operation there is no cold in the chamber and the compressor is humming, perhaps the thermostat simply does not give the command to start. Conversely, if the temperature drops below -24°C and the food freezes, although the knob is set to minimum, the contacts do not open.

⚠️ Attention: Before carrying out any diagnostic work on the electrical part, be sure to disconnect the refrigerator from the network. Even briefly touching exposed live wires can cause serious injury.

More accurate diagnostics can be carried out using a multimeter set to dial mode. To do this, you will need to dismantle the assembly, which will be discussed below, and check the resistance at the contacts. At room temperature, the contacts should be closed (the multimeter beeps), and when the sensitive tube is cooled (for example, in a freezer), they should open. If the circuit does not respond to changes in the temperature of the sensitive element, replacement of the thermostat is inevitable.

Preparation of tools and selection of spare parts

The success of the repair largely depends on the correctness of the selected spare part. Refrigerators Minsk and Atlant most often use thermostats of the TAM, K-59, K-50 series or imported analogues from Danfoss and Ranco. It is important to pay attention to the length capillary tubeas it can vary from 0.7 to 2.5 meters. A tube that is too long can be carefully rolled up, but a short one cannot be extended.

When purchasing a new part, be sure to check the markings on the body of the old device. Although many thermostats are interchangeable, different models refrigerators Minsk may have nuances in the location of the contacts and the length of the rod. If it is difficult to find an original part, you can use universal analogs, selecting them according to the temperature range of operation.

Removing the old thermostat

The process of removing a faulty unit begins with providing access to it. In most models Minsk the thermostat is located inside the refrigerator compartment, next to the lampshade or in a corner under the ceiling. First you need to remove the plastic temperature control knob, which is usually simply pulled onto the rod with a little force.

Next, you should dismantle the protective casing or lamp shade, which is often secured with latches or screws. Be careful with plastic elements, as they become brittle with time and cold and can crack if handled carelessly. After removing the cladding, you will have access to the thermostat thermostat itself and the wires suitable for it.

A critically important step is to fix the wire connection diagram. Do not rely on memory as color coding may be off-color or faded. Before disconnecting the terminals, take a photo or sketch which wire went to which terminal. Then carefully remove the terminals and unscrew the mount of the thermostat itself.

The most delicate part of the operation is removal capillary tube from the evaporator. It can be secured in a special channel or pressed with a bar. Do not pull the tube with force, as it will easily bend or burst, which will render the new part unusable. Carefully straighten the tube inside the chamber and pull it through the hole in the housing.

Installation of a new thermostat and connection

Installation of a new one thermostat is carried out in the reverse order of dismantling. First, carefully thread the capillary tube through the hole in the chamber wall. The length of the protruding part must match the original so that the sensing element correctly reads the temperature of the air or the surface of the evaporator. If the tube is too long, you can carefully lay it like a snake along the wall, avoiding sharp kinks.

Secure the thermostat housing in its original place using screws or latches. Make sure it fits snugly and does not wobble, as vibration from the compressor can damage the contacts over time. Now is the time to refer to the diagram made earlier and connect the wires to the appropriate terminals.

Contact marking Wire color (usually) Function
3 (or L) Red / Brown Power supply (Phase)
4 (or 1) Black / Orange Compressor
6 (or 2) Green / Yellow Lamp / Signal

After connecting the wires, check that the terminals are securely fastened. They should fit tightly, without play. If the contacts are oxidized, they can be carefully sanded with fine sandpaper before insertion. Assemble the plastic casing and install the adjustment knob in place, aligning the mark with the scale divisions.

⚠️ Attention: Never turn on the refrigerator if the thermostat capillary tube is damaged, creased, or has traces of oil. Freon leakage from the sensitive flask will cause the thermostat to stop working correctly.

Checking performance and setting

After assembling all the elements, you can plug refrigerator Minsk into the network. In the first minutes of operation, listen to the sounds: the thermostat should click, and after a few seconds the compressor will start. If the motor hums but does not start, the problem may be in the start relay, not the thermostat, or the wires are not connected correctly.

Let the unit idle (without food) for 2-3 hours. During this time, it should gain temperature and turn off. If the compressor runs continuously for more than an hour and does not turn off, try turning the control knob counterclockwise. If the shutdown still does not occur, perhaps the new thermostat requires adjustment or is defective.

Fine-tuning the temperature

If the refrigerator freezes too much even at the minimum setting, some models of thermostats (for example, TAM) have an adjusting screw under the seal. Turning this screw 1/4 turn can change the temperature range, but this should only be done with experience and a thermometer.

The normal mode is when the compressor takes up about 30-40% of the cycle time. For example, he works for 10 minutes, rests for 15-20 minutes. It depends on the ambient temperature in the room and the amount of food. If the cycle is followed and the temperature in the main chamber is kept within +2...+5°C, the repair can be considered successful.

Typical mistakes in self-repair

One ​​of the most common mistakes is ignoring grounding. In older models Minsk the housing often does not have full grounding, and if the compressor insulation breaks down, a dangerous potential may appear on it. When installing a new thermostat, make sure that all insulating casings are in place.

Also, novice craftsmen often damage the capillary tube during installation. Even a microscopic crack will lead to the release of filler gas, and the thermostat will “go deaf”, ceasing to respond to temperature. Treat the copper tube like a crystal vase.

  • ❌ Incorrect connection of wires to the contact group (leads to a short circuit).
  • ❌ Excessive tension of the capillary tube (risk of rupture).
  • ❌ Using a thermostat with inappropriate temperature range (for example, for a freezer instead of a refrigerator).

Do not forget about the cleanliness of the contacts. If, during replacement, oxides are not removed from the terminals of the compressor or the thermostat itself, a transition resistance will arise at the connection point, leading to heating and eventual burning of the contacts. Cleaning contacts is an obligatory stage of high-quality repairs.

Frequently asked questions (FAQ)

Is it possible to temporarily close the thermostat contacts to make the refrigerator work?

Technically, you can close the wires, and the compressor will start working continuously. However, this will lead to uncontrolled freezing of food and possible compressor failure due to lack of rest. This solution is only permissible for a couple of hours to defrost the system before replacing the part.

What is the difference between the TAM-133 thermostat and the K-59?

The main difference is the design of the rod and the temperature range of operation. TAM-133 often has a longer stem and is intended for certain models refrigerators Minsk. K-59 is considered a more universal analogue, but during installation a slight modification to the fastening or length of the tube may be required.

Why does the new thermostat click, but the compressor does not start?

If there is a click, then the thermostat is working. The problem may be in the compressor start relay, in the motor itself (turn-to-turn short circuit), or in incorrectly connected wires. It is also worth checking the presence of voltage in the outlet and the integrity of the power cord.
